Elliptic method generates composite grids about three-dimensional aircraft body. Grid lines on surface of wing and body vary in spacing, depending on level of detail needed to model airflow accurately in region. Grid intervals for zone might be unchanged in one direction, halved in second orthogonal direction, and reduced to much finer spacing in third direction. Computer generates grids with little or no human intervention.
